I bought it hoping to improve my complexion and blemishes, but I haven't seen much effect yet. I've used about half the bottle. If you think of it as just an essence to use after toner, rather than a vitamin C serum, it seems like a decent product to use. It's not extremely oily or moisturizing, but it somehow absorbs into the skin really well, like it's meant to be there. The scent seems to be a matter of personal preference, but I found it to be fine.
ConsMaybe because it contains a lot of vitamin C, it tends to stain my pillow when I apply it at night and go to sleep. Even when I'm lazy on weekends and only wash my face with water, it leaves very yellow stains on the towel. It might not seem like a big deal, but if your bedding is white, it can be quite annoying and bothersome. Also, the container has a dropper, but you have to close it very carefully, otherwise it leaks from the sides. The leaked product then discolors and hardens, making the container opening messy.
TipAll in all, I think this is a product without any significant pros or cons, so I don't plan to repurchase it. It's not particularly attractive price-wise if you're only looking for hydration...

I definitely felt it absorbing quickly into my skin. The best part was feeling it truly penetrate the skin. Also, it left no residue, so I could layer a hydrating essence on top without any heaviness. I've been using it morning and night for about two weeks now, and most of the blemishes I got from wearing a mask for long periods have subsided. Regarding the scent, which some reviews mention, it's a bit unique, but I found it tolerable and had no issues using it.
ConsConsidering the short 2-month use-by period after opening, the amount seems a bit much. I'm not sure if I can use it all up in time. It's quite pricey, so you'll want to watch for sales. Also, the dropper comes loose in the box without separate packaging, which feels a bit unsanitary. You might want to sterilize it before use.

As someone with oily skin, I usually struggle with heavy products like ampoules, but this one feels light and refreshing when you control the quantity and help it absorb well. - Since it's not too cold yet, I recommend those with oily skin to keep their base skincare light when using this! - I've been using it for just under two weeks, and the most noticeable improvement has been in my skin texture! It also helps with dead skin cells, and I'm so grateful because my skin has been rough lately due to lack of sleep, but this has made it feel so much softer.
Cons- Because of its viscosity, quite a bit of product tends to stick to the outside of the dropper. The bottle opening is quite narrow, so you need to be careful when inserting and removing the dropper to avoid getting product all over the opening. Other than that, I didn't find any particular downsides! - Scent: It was fine for me, but it's on the stronger side, so it might not suit those sensitive to fragrances.
Tip- As expected with heavier formulas like ampoules, it seems to absorb best when you warm it between your palms and then press it into your skin! I recommend this method if you find the finish too sticky. - Being a Vitamin C product, there's definitely a slight warming or tingling sensation. Those with super sensitive skin should take note!

It's not overly oily, so it doesn't just sit on the surface. As you massage it in, you'll notice it absorbs well, without leaving any sticky residue. Hydration: Despite being a serum, it provides excellent moisturizing benefits. As someone with dry skin, I can still feel the hydrating effects when I wash my face in the morning. Even in warm weather, I didn't experience any dryness using just a light toner and this product (perfect for evening out skin tone without needing a heavy cream).
ConsDropper (Container): I've noticed many other reviewers mentioning this too. The straight tube design of the dropper can cause the product to spill out if you're not careful. La Roche-Posay really needs to address this issue. Wrinkle Improvement and Soothing: I started using this to round out my skincare routine, but I haven't seen any noticeable effects on wrinkles yet. To be fair, I don't have many wrinkles to begin with. Similarly, I didn't experience any significant soothing effects, and it even caused a slight tingling sensation on sensitive areas.
